How to use
Warm a small amount in the palms. Apply to scalp and hair roots. Massage gently with fingertips for 10–15 minutes using circular motions. Leave on for 30–60 minutes or overnight. Cleanse with a mild shampoo. Use 2–3 times per week or as part of your routine.
